Edition 2025 — Bonfires of Saint Anthony Abbot

In 2025, Rocchetta Sant'Antonio once again celebrated its patron saint with the traditional bonfires of Saint Anthony Abbot. On the night between January 16th and 17th, piles of straw and broom lit up the Monti Dauni village, with buffets of local products and the traditional dinner, while the saint's day saw the renewal of the blessing of the animals. An event experienced by the locals as the village's true New Year.

The 2025 edition of the Patronal Feast of Saint Anthony Abbot confirmed the vitality of one of the most deeply rooted fire traditions in the northern province of Foggia. As is customary, on the evening of January 16th, the large straw and broom bonfires illuminated the historic center of Rocchetta Sant'Antonio, attracting residents, returning emigrants, and visitors from the Monti Dauni. The festival combined the religious dimension with a convivial one, featuring buffets of local products, the traditional dinner of 'ruoto di capuzza di agnello e patate', and, on January 17th, the blessing of domestic animals and livestock on the patron saint's day.
